.text {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#2276B6;
}
.news {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#094991;
}

.titre {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 13px;
	color: #094991;
}

.form {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 9px;
	color: #094991;
}

input.login {
	height: 15px;
	width: 75px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#2276B6;
}

input.contact {
	height: 18px;
	width: 175px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#2276B6;
}

input.longcontact {
	height: 18px;
	width: 220px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#2276B6;
}

input.valid {
	height: 20px;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#2276B6;
	background: #ffffff
}

a {
	text-decoration : underline;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 11px;
	color : #094991;
} 
a:hover {text-decoration : none}
a:active {text-decoration : none}

a.retour {
	text-decoration : none;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 10px;
	color : #094991;
} 
a.retour:hover {text-decoration : underline}
a.retour:active {text-decoration : none}
select {
	font-family: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#2276B6;
	height: 20px;
}
a.under {
	text-decoration : none;
	font-family : Arial, Helvetica, sans-serif;
	font-size : 11px;
	color : #094991;
} 
a.under:hover {text-decoration : none}
a.under:active {text-decoration : none}